Review: The Pinball Theory of Apocalypse

A book that comes with a cool website, and vice versa.

Anyhow, I really had fun reading this book. I was reading an advanced copy. The book won’t be on sale until August of this year, so you have to wait just a little while before you can get a hold of one for yourself. The fun doesn’t end when you get through the last page, however, because it turns out there are two websites connected to this book. One showcases some of Isabel’s paintings, and the other gives further details on her father’s work “The Pinball Theory of Apocalypse”. I just love it when books have cool websites that go with them!
